Acts 8:36

Context
8:36 Now as they were going along the road, they came to some water, and the eunuch said, “Look, there is water! What is to stop me 1  from being baptized?”

Acts 13:10

Context
13:10 and said, “You who are full of all deceit and all wrongdoing, 2  you son of the devil, you enemy of all righteousness – will you not stop making crooked the straight paths of the Lord? 3 

1 tn Or “What prevents me.” The rhetorical question means, “I should get baptized, right?”

2 tn Or “unscrupulousness.”

3 sn “You who…paths of the Lord?” This rebuke is like ones from the OT prophets: Jer 5:27; Gen 32:11; Prov 10:7; Hos 14:9. Five separate remarks indicate the magician’s failings. The closing rhetorical question of v. 10 (“will you not stop…?”) shows how opposed he is to the way of God.
